Crystallization
Crystalization Experiments | ||||
---|---|---|---|---|
ID | Method | pH | Temperature | Details |
1 | VAPOR DIFFUSION, HANGING DROP | 293 | Crystals of the host-guest complex were obtained in 5 mM magnesium acetate, 50 mM ADA, pH 6.5, 9% PEG4000. To obtain complexes with BLM, crystals were soaked in well solutions containing 0.1 mM BLM followed by stabilization in 9% PEG4000, 5 mM magnesium acetate, 100 mM HEPES pH 8.0, 20% ethylene glycol, 0.25 mM BLM until unit cell changes correlating with binding of BLM were detected. |
